Transaction 504b917404c2d079a4f07f5bd79e9c03761a7f4ee0b3cdcc1d10204e86aec996
1 Input
2 Outputs
- 504b917404c2d079a4f07f5bd79e9c03761a7f4ee0b3cdcc1d10204e86aec996:0
- 504b917404c2d079a4f07f5bd79e9c03761a7f4ee0b3cdcc1d10204e86aec996:1
value 558691868
address 1HCviLYNqHAyeZxGTj9Mtgvj1NJgQuSo91
value 41110000
address 38wcDuKSDYTTWyDW3XosfbmgKDkaXZ3HSy